“Sheriff” – “Iskra-Stal”. The coaches’ opinion
/ 22 April
FC “Sheriff” head coach Leonid Kuchuk: “The opposing team was defending itself very well and conducting counterattacks during all the game. We failed to build a dangerous and fast play. All pickings up were lost. We were at the advantage but let the opponents through to attack. So, I had to make a bit of a noise in the interval and explain my players how to play football. A good footballer should play not only by feet, one wins who thinks fast on the field. In the second half time we accelerated both play and our thoughts and goals came. We tried not to allow the opponents to develop their attacks. It worked well and the game was a success although the first half time was very hard.”
 
FC “Iskra-Stal” head coach Vlad Goyan: “A match against “Sheriff” is an index of preparedness at the moment. We play with teams of a lower level and show a good football but today “Sheriff” made it clear for all of us what place we stand. There is nothing to comment.
 
- What basic mistakes were made by your team in the match?
- There was no play, we poorly controlled the game and the opponent crushed us. A team which respects itself has no right to concede three goals following the set pieces in one match. It was the merit of “Sheriff” that we failed to build the play.
